In rural farming zones, dust is not merely a nuisance—it is a dynamic hazard that reduces contrast, obscures hazards, and challenges judgment. Weather patterns, plowing, harvest, and irrigation create swirling plumes that can envelop a vehicle without warning. Effective management begins long before the road: choose routes with fewer unpaved stretches when possible, schedule travel during calmer periods, and ensure your vehicle is equipped with operational protections such as functional headlights, clean windshields, and a reliable horn. A proactive mindset helps you respond to rapid changes rather than reacting after a near-miss. Establishing standard operating procedures for dusty conditions sets a safety baseline for every trip.
Visibility management hinges on meticulous observation, disciplined speed control, and clear signaling. When dusty conditions intensify, drop your speed gradually to maintain traction, avoid sudden braking, and increase following distance behind slower equipment or pedestrians. Use lane discipline to keep a predictable path, and maintain a margin of safety that accounts for braking distance in loose surfaces. The air quality inside the cabin matters too; run the ventilation to prevent fogging and ensure the driver’s eyes stay free of sweat and debris. Regularly clean windshields and wipers, and keep spare fluids available so you don’t stall due to clogged filters or evaporated reservoirs in heat.
Adaptive driving requires steady planning, calm judgment, and constant vigilance.
Preparation for dust storms or plumes includes a quick risk assessment before departure. Check weather forecasts, farm work schedules, and field conditions that could escalate visibility issues. Ensure lighting is bright and clean, especially on the vehicle’s front and sides, so signals are unmistakable to other operators. Have a plan for unexpected halts: know safe pull-off points, know where field access roads end, and identify secure areas away from machinery. Communicate with the farm crew to understand if equipment movement creates sudden dust pockets. Carry emergency items such as a reflective vest, flashlight, and a charged mobile device to call for help if visibility deteriorates beyond safe limits.
During low-visibility episodes, the driver’s decision-making becomes the decisive factor in safety. Maintain a calm, deliberate pace and anticipate the movements of others in the area. If you encounter a sudden dust wall, use controlled deceleration and a smooth steering input to avoid losing control. Keep your head on a swivel, scanning the horizon for silhouettes of tractors, harvesters, or vehicles that may emerge from the dust. Use the vehicle’s indicators consistently so others understand your intentions, especially when visibility is limited and line-of-sight is compromised. If conditions worsen to the point where the road is almost invisible, consider stopping at a designated safe area until conditions improve.

When dust is lifting from fields behind you, your vehicle can be hit with gusts that destabilize handling. Wait moments after a gust passes before resuming acceleration to avoid oversteering. If you must overtake, choose wider, clearer segments and ensure there is ample space ahead to account for erratic changes in speed from the vehicle in front. Regularly adjust seat positions to keep a clear view of the horizon and instrument panel. Keep a reliable communication method online or via radio with the farm crew so they can alert you to emerging hazards, such as a closing tractor line or pedestrians rushing across the field edge. Environmental awareness matters just as much as vehicle control. Dust often accompanies varying terrain like gravel lanes, furrows, or muddy patches that reduce tire grip. Adjust your driving to the surface: lighten the load if possible, spread weight evenly, and avoid sharp throttle inputs that can kick up more dust. Traction control is useful, but your best defense is smooth, progressive inputs. If you encounter a washboard surface, mirror the rhythm of your steering and avoid abrupt lane changes. Routine checks of tires, brakes, and suspension prevent unexpected failures that could be exacerbated by limited visibility. Plan for longer distances between landmarks because familiar cues may vanish in dense dust.

Signaling becomes critical when sight lines narrow. Use hazard lights judiciously to alert others when you reduce speed significantly or encounter a temporary fog bank. Maintain a steady heartbeat of communication with the truck, implement, and field operators to manage the flow of machinery. If you drive with a convoy or alongside agricultural equipment, establish clear hand signals or radio codes to indicate hazards, stops, and the need to slow down. Redundant cues help bridge the gap created by dust. The right training ensures every team member understands these cues, preventing misinterpretations that could lead to collisions or injuries. In addition to signaling, locate your crew’s positions so you can anticipate their movements. When dust is heavy, field machinery may reposition suddenly, including combines pulling onto the road or tractors entering from field edges. Map out typical crossing points and ensure you can pause safely without blocking the flow of other traffic. If you’re transporting livestock or sensitive cargo, extra precautions are warranted; dust can irritate animals and erode their comfort, demanding slower speeds and gentler braking. Proper loading can prevent shifting that worsens stability in dusty conditions. Regular checks of load security help deter equipment instability during abrupt dust-driven gusts.

When a dust episode begins, lower your speed early rather than waiting for visibility to vanish. This approach gives you time to react to sudden obstacles that may appear without warning. Tap the brakes gradually rather than slamming them; abrupt deceleration can cause a chain reaction among following vehicles. Maintain a well-spaced gap behind the vehicle ahead to absorb unpredictable deceleration. If the dust becomes intense enough to obscure the lead vehicle, switch on high-beam headlights only if there is no oncoming traffic and the lane is clear. Otherwise, use low beams and fog lights if available to improve perception of the road edge and roadside indicators.
Adapting your route can minimize exposure to extreme dust. If possible, choose routes with paved stretches, wider shoulders, and fewer blind curves. Slow down further as you approach intersections, farm gates, or approaches to busy field edges. Keep an alert mental tempo; dusty conditions demand sustained attention rather than bursts of focus. Engage passenger help if you have a second person on board to assist with navigation and to keep you anchored to the safest path.
After a dusty pass, perform a post-incident debrief with the crew. Review what happened, what signals were effective, and whether any equipment performed suboptimally under dust. Check for opportunities to improve the route or timing to reduce exposure on future trips. Document any weather events that affected visibility for regulatory or insurance purposes, including wind direction and gust intensity. Use a structured checklist to verify that lights, wipers, and cameras are functioning. Share lessons learned with other drivers in your fleet to raise the overall standard of practice. Finally, invest in ongoing training for drivers and field operators. Dust dynamics can evolve with seasonal changes, new crop practices, and equipment upgrades. Training modules should cover perception under reduced visibility, communication protocols, and emergency procedures. Include scenario-based drills that simulate sudden dust fronts or gusts and require coordinated responses. Encourage feedback from drivers about equipment and road conditions, then translate that feedback into concrete safety improvements.
